The badge has fine detail and it's non-magnetic, thin metal (~0.4 mm), size about 23 mm x 20 mm. The style of prongs I haven't come across when searching the internet, so that has me thinking it might be fake (on the other hand, given the imperfect soldering, they might have been added afterward during a repair).
In the event that I would be real, would this be a Panzer lapel insignia, or one of those imperial cap skulls? (or when not real, what were they trying to fake )

I'm leaning towards a cast copy of a an early type panzer collar insignia like these from my collection. While it has nice detail on the front, the reverse side of the badge shows signs of being made in a mold not stamped.
